99久久久精品免费观看国产,紧身短裙女教师波多野,正在播放暮町ゆう子在线观看,欧美激情综合色综合啪啪五月

千鋒教育-做有情懷、有良心、有品質的職業教育機構

手機站
千鋒教育

千鋒學習站 | 隨時隨地免費學

千鋒教育

掃一掃進入千鋒手機站

領取全套視頻
千鋒教育

關注千鋒學習站小程序
隨時隨地免費學習課程

當前位置:首頁  >  技術干貨  > Web前端開發工具有哪些?

Web前端開發工具有哪些?

來源:千鋒教育
發布人:xqq
時間: 2023-10-13 22:58:11 1697209091

一、代碼編輯器

代碼編輯器是Web前端開發的基礎工具之一,用于編寫、編輯和修改計算機代碼。它通常支持多種編程語言,并提供了一些便捷的功能,如語法高亮、代碼折疊、自動補全和代碼格式化等,以幫助程序員更快、更準確地編寫代碼。以下是一些常用的代碼編輯器:

1、Visual Studio Code

Visual Studio Code是一款由微軟開發的免費開源的跨平臺代碼編輯器。它支持大量的編程語言,并且有豐富的插件市場,可以滿足不同開發者的需求。此外,它還提供了豐富的調試功能和集成的終端,方便開發者進行調試和運行程序。

2、Sublime Text

Sublime Text是一款輕量級的代碼編輯器,它具有快速、穩定、易用等特點。它支持多種編程語言,并且有豐富的插件和主題,可以滿足不同開發者的需求。此外,它還提供了強大的搜索和替換功能,方便開發者查找和修改代碼。

3、Atom

Atom是一款由GitHub開發的免費開源的跨平臺代碼編輯器。它支持多種編程語言,并且有豐富的插件和主題,可以滿足不同開發者的需求。此外,它還提供了集成的Git和GitHub功能,方便開發者進行版本控制和協作開發。

4、WebStorm

WebStorm是一款由JetBrains開發的專業前端開發工具。它具有智能代碼補全、錯誤檢查、調試和版本控制等功能,適用于JavaScript、HTML和CSS的開發和調試。

5、Notepad++

Notepad++是一款免費開源的代碼編輯器,支持多窗口編輯、拖拽文本編輯、多語言界面、插件擴展等功能。它的界面簡潔明了,功能強大,易于使用。此外,它還支持正則表達式搜索和替換,方便程序員進行復雜的文本處理。

二、調試工具

調試是Web前端開發中必不可少的工作,它可以幫助開發者找出代碼中的錯誤并進行修復。調試工具可以提供一些便捷的功能,如斷點設置、變量監視、堆棧跟蹤、內存分析等,以幫助程序員更快、更準確地定位和修復錯誤。下面我們將介紹幾款比較流行的調試工具:

1、Chrome DevTools

Chrome DevTools是一款由Google開發的調試工具,它可以幫助開發者進行代碼調試、性能分析、頁面樣式調整等工作。它提供了豐富的調試功能和工具,例如控制臺、元素查看器、網絡面板等,方便開發者進行調試和優化。

2、Firebug

Firebug是一款由Mozilla開發的免費調試工具,它可以幫助開發者進行代碼調試、頁面樣式調整、性能分析等工作。它提供了豐富的調試功能和工具,例如控制臺、元素查看器、網絡面板等,方便開發者進行調試和優化。

3、Safari Web Inspector

Safari Web Inspector是一款由Apple開發的調試工具,它可以幫助開發者進行代碼調試、性能分析、頁面樣式調整等工作。它提供了豐富的調試功能和工具,例如控制臺、元素查看器、網絡面板等,方便開發者進行調試和優化。

三、構建工具

構建工具是一類用于自動化構建和打包Web前端應用程序的工具。在前端開發中,通常需要將多個源代碼文件(如HTML、CSS、JavaScript等)進行處理、優化和合并,生成用于生產環境的最終文件。構建工具能夠幫助開發人員自動執行這些繁瑣的構建任務,提高開發效率并優化項目性能。以下是幾個常用的前端構建工具:

1、Webpack

Webpack是目前較受歡迎的前端構建工具之一。它采用模塊化的方式處理各種資源文件,如 JavaScript、CSS、圖片等,并提供了強大的代碼分割、文件壓縮、靜態資源優化等功能。通過配置webpack,開發人員可以定制出適合自己項目需求的構建流程。

2、Grunt

Grunt是一款由JavaScript任務運行工具,可以幫助開發者自動化執行重復的任務,例如代碼壓縮、文件合并等。它提供了豐富的插件和配置選項,可以滿足不同項目的需求。此外,它還可以與其他工具集成,例如JSHint、Sass等。

3、Gulp

Gulp 是一種基于流的構建工具,它通過定義任務(task)的方式來處理各種構建操作。Gulp 提供了一系列插件,用于處理文件的復制、編譯、壓縮等操作,并可以通過管道(pipe)的方式串聯任務。相較于Webpack,Gulp 更加靈活和可定制。

四、包管理工具

包管理工具可以幫助開發人員輕松地下載、安裝、更新和卸載這些依賴項,以確保項目的可靠性和穩定性。常用的包管理工具有:

1、npm

npm是一款由JavaScript包管理工具,它可以幫助開發者管理和安裝依賴包,并且提供了豐富的包搜索和發布功能。它是Node.js的官方包管理工具,也可以用于瀏覽器端的開發。

2、Yarn

Yarn是一款由Facebook開發的包管理工具,它可以幫助開發者管理和安裝依賴包,并且提供了豐富的包搜索和緩存功能。它的安裝速度比npm快,而且可以并行下載依賴包,提高依賴包的安裝效率。

五、框架工具

框架是Web前端開發中常用的工具,它可以幫助開發者快速構建Web應用程序,并且提供了豐富的功能和組件。下面介紹幾款比較流行的框架:

1、React

React是一款由Facebook開發的JavaScript框架,它可以幫助開發者構建高性能、可復用的Web應用程序。它使用組件化的方式構建UI界面,提高了代碼的可維護性和可重用性。此外,它還提供了豐富的生命周期函數和狀態管理機制,方便開發者進行狀態管理和數據傳遞。

2、Vue

Vue是一款由Evan You開發的JavaScript框架,它可以幫助開發者構建響應式的Web應用程序。它采用了組件化的方式構建UI界面,提高了代碼的可維護性和可重用性。此外,它還提供了豐富的指令和計算屬性,方便開發者進行數據處理和狀態管理。

3、Angular

Angular是一款由Google開發的JavaScript框架,它可以幫助開發者構建大型、復雜的Web應用程序。它采用了組件化的方式構建UI界面,提高了代碼的可維護性和可重用性。此外,它還提供了豐富的指令、服務和依賴注入機制,方便開發者進行數據處理和狀態管理。

以上是目前比較流行的Web前端開發工具,它們可以讓開發者更加專注于業務邏輯的實現,提高開發效率和代碼質量。隨著技術的不斷發展,這些工具也會不斷地更新和升級,為開發者提供更好的開發體驗。

聲明:本站稿件版權均屬千鋒教育所有,未經許可不得擅自轉載。
10年以上業內強師集結,手把手帶你蛻變精英
請您保持通訊暢通,專屬學習老師24小時內將與您1V1溝通
免費領取
今日已有369人領取成功
劉同學 138****2860 剛剛成功領取
王同學 131****2015 剛剛成功領取
張同學 133****4652 剛剛成功領取
李同學 135****8607 剛剛成功領取
楊同學 132****5667 剛剛成功領取
岳同學 134****6652 剛剛成功領取
梁同學 157****2950 剛剛成功領取
劉同學 189****1015 剛剛成功領取
張同學 155****4678 剛剛成功領取
鄒同學 139****2907 剛剛成功領取
董同學 138****2867 剛剛成功領取
周同學 136****3602 剛剛成功領取
相關推薦HOT
主站蜘蛛池模板: 国产国语一级毛片| 动漫触手被吸乳羞羞动漫| 日产国产欧美韩国在线| 哇嘎在线观看电影| 日日夜夜精品免费视频| 午夜一区二区在线观看| 久久精品久久久久观看99水蜜桃| 黑人干白人| 美女扒开尿口让男人捅| 欧洲美女与动zozo| 调教家政妇第38话无删减| 7777精品久久久大香线蕉| 日本嫩交| 触手强制h受孕本子里番| 好大好硬好爽免费视频| 精品久久久久久久久中文字幕| 日本三人交xxx69| 久久精品中文字幕一区| 香港一级毛片免费看| 羞羞的漫画sss| 免费大片黄在线观看| 91精品国产高清久久久久| 男女做爽爽免费视频| 爱情岛亚洲论坛在线观看| 成年女人免费视频播放体验区| 免费观看黄网站| 日本电影娼年| 国产馆在线观看| 污动漫3d| 国产大学生一级毛片绿象| 成年美女黄网站色大片免费看| 国产精品久久国产精品99| 日韩手机视频| 日本在线观看一级高清片| 97久久精品午夜一区二区| www.夜夜操.com| 波多野结衣动态图| 国产白丝在线观看| 亚洲影院adc| 日本人六九视频jⅰzzz| 一本热久久sm色国产|